Manufacturer & distributor of standard & custom packaging & cushioning products. Packaging products include protective packaging products such as boxes, bags, corrugated cartons, shipping cases, More... chipboard, foam packaging, rubberized bound fiber, animal & rubberized hair, plastic materials, custom crating & pallets, protective shippers, strapping systems, foam shapes, tapes & stretch wraps. Specializing in packaging products that meet government & military specifications, wood crates, skids & foams. Capabilities include packaging design, tooling & engineering, fabrication, testing, warehousing & integration. JIT delivery. Meeting PPP-C-1120 & ISPM-15 specifications.
